Pleochroism

Pleochroism of cordierite shown by rotating a polarizing filter on the lens of the camera
Pleochroism of tourmaline shown by rotating a polarizing filter on the lens of the camera

Pleochroism is an optical phenomenon in which a substance has different colors when observed at different angles, especially with polarized light.[1]
